POLITICAL BRIEFS: Scoop Declares

In his quest for the Democratic presidential nomination, Senator Henry Jackson has rated up to an unimpressive 8% in the national polls. Indeed, there is some fear in his camp that Scoop could poop out long before next summer's nominating convention unless he rapidly becomes better known among voters and matches strides with the front runners in the initial presidential primaries. So Jackson has decided to enter the fray officially next week, and with a big bang.
